1. The Rise of Apartment Living in Lahore

Traditionally, Lahoris have preferred independent homes with spacious lawns and multiple stories. However, over the last decade, the apartment culture has steadily gained traction. Several factors have contributed to this shift:

1.1 Urbanization and Population Growth

Lahore’s population exceeds 13 million and continues to grow. With limited land availability and rising property prices, vertical expansion has become necessary.

1.2 Changing Family Structures

Nuclear families and single professionals now prefer apartments for their affordability and ease of maintenance. This has created a strong demand for one and two-bedroom apartments.

1.3 Lifestyle Preferences

Apartments in modern complexes often come with amenities like gyms, pools, parks, and 24/7 security—features that appeal to younger, urban populations.

3. Prime Locations for Apartments in Lahore

Several neighborhoods and housing societies in Lahore have emerged as apartment hubs. Let’s look at some of the most sought-after areas:

3.1 Gulberg

A central business and residential area, Gulberg is known for upscale apartments, commercial hubs, and excellent connectivity. Projects like Nishat Residences and Indigo Heights are popular choices.

3.2 DHA (Defence Housing Authority)

DHA is synonymous with secure and organized living. From DHA Phase 2 to the newer Phase 8, apartments here are known for quality construction, modern designs, and strong resale value.

3.3 Bahria Town

Bahria Town Lahore is a self-contained community offering gated security, wide roads, green belts, and a range of apartment options at relatively affordable prices.

3.4 Johar Town

Well-developed and centrally located, Johar Town is home to educational institutions and hospitals. Apartments here are ideal for families and working professionals.

3.5 Askari Housing Scheme

Askari apartments, especially in Askari 10 and 11, are built with military precision and provide strong infrastructure and security.

5. Real Estate Market Trends

The real estate market in Lahore is dynamic and constantly evolving. Here’s what you need to know:

5.1 Price Trends

Luxury apartments in areas like Gulberg or DHA can range from PKR 3 crore to 10 crore, depending on the size and location.

Mid-range apartments in Johar Town or Model Town Extension fall between PKR 70 lakh to 2 crore.

Budget apartments in areas like Ferozepur Road or Multan Road can start from PKR 30 lakh.

5.2 Rental Market

A one-bedroom apartment in central Lahore may rent for PKR 40,000 to 70,000 per month.

Larger apartments in upscale neighborhoods can fetch PKR 1 lakh or more per month.

7. Legal and Regulatory Aspects

Before purchasing or investing in an apartment in Lahore, it is essential to understand legal procedures:

7.1 Property Verification

Always verify the title deed, NOC approvals, and developer credentials. Many fraudulent schemes operate without proper licensing.

7.2 Transfer Process

Once verified, the transfer of ownership involves stamp duty, registration fees, and official documentation with the Lahore Development Authority (LDA).

7.3 Apartment Ownership Rights

Understand bylaws related to shared spaces, maintenance fees, renovation rights, and resale terms outlined by housing societies or apartment management bodies.

8. Challenges of Apartment Living

Despite numerous advantages, apartment living comes with its set of challenges:

Lack of Privacy: Shared walls and close quarters may affect personal space.

Maintenance Charges: Monthly maintenance costs can be high in luxury apartments.

Limited Outdoor Space: Unlike independent houses, gardens or open patios are rare.

Rules and Regulations: Restrictions on pets, visitors, noise levels, and renovations may apply.
